             Summary: Distribution Event Packages should contain queue item 
creation time

Currently the Dsitribution Event package contains the following details:
 * Distribution Component Name
 * Distribution Component Kind
 * Distribution Type
 * Distribution Paths

 

Improvement aims at adding the queue item creation time, essentially when the 
the item was creation for the first time, and enqueue into the queue. The value 
does not change over retries (on failure).

 

The purpose to get this detail is to be able to capture metrics at the consumer 
level. The consumers could have an event handler, which can capture the 
duration which turns out to be (NOW - queue item creation time thrown in the 
distribution event package); NOW being the current time in the event handler 
(consumer).
